Albury Park Mansion, Albury, Surrey

Part of the Duke of Northumberland’s 150-acre Surrey estate, Albury Park has a history pre-dating 1066. The home once played host to the coronation banquet of King George III and features iconic architecture, including 63 individually designed chimneys which were created in the early 19th century to give the ramshackle house a Gothic-Tudor-style makeover. The Grade II listed estate has now been divided into multiple plots within five acres of private formal gardens.
